牛牛!向前冲!
牛牛!向前冲!
全部文章
Android
Android面试(1)
未归档(1)
面试/面经(3)
归档
标签
去牛客网
登录
/
注册
牛牛!向前冲!的博客
全部文章
/ Android
(共130篇)
《Jetpack Compose入门到精通》,拥抱全新Android UI 开发框架!
历时两年,2021年7月29日 Jetpack Compose 正式版终于问世。对于 Jetpack Compose ,相信有很多同学会有很多疑惑的地方。 Jetpack Compose 有学习的必要吗? Jetpack Compose 存在哪些特点和优势? 与传统UI相比,Jetpack Com...
Android
compose
2021-11-23
0
675
Android入门教程 | OkHttp + Retrofit 使用
OkHttp + Retrofit使用示例。从引入依赖,编写接口,到发起网络请求。 引入依赖 引入依赖,使用Retrofit2。 implementation 'com.squareup.retrofit2:retrofit:2.1.0' implementation 'com.squareup.r...
Android
2021-11-23
0
420
Android入门教程 | OkHttp 入门
OkHttp 是一款HTTP客户端。 特点: 连接池减少请求延迟(在HTTP/2不可用的情况下) 传输GZIP时减少下载体积 缓存相同请求的回复 OkHttp 能从连接故障中静默恢复。如果服务有多个 IP 地址,如果第一次访问失败,它会尝试其他地址。 这功能对 IPv4+IPv6 和多个 hos...
Android
2021-11-22
0
740
Android入门教程 | SharedPreferences 简介
有时候我们想在应用中存储一些数据。比如一些配置信息。 例如存储int,float,boolean,字符串这类的数据。 写文件可能会比较繁琐。需要自己实现文件读写操作,定义数据存放结构。 对于这些简单的数据,我们可以用 SharedPreferences (下文或简称sp)来进行存储。 sp 使用的是...
Android
2021-11-18
0
415
Android入门教程 | mmap 文件映射介绍
Android 开发中,我们可能需要记录一些文件。例如记录 log 文件。如果使用流来写文件,频繁操作文件 io 可能会引起性能问题。 为了降低写文件的频率,我们可能会采用缓存一定数量的 log,再一次性把它们写到文件中。如果 app 异常退出,我们有可能会丢失内存中的 log 信息。 那么有什么比...
Android
2021-11-17
0
853
音视频,时代的风口浪尖!Android 开发者的新机遇!
前言 实时音视频,正处在时代的风口上。 随着移动互联网的蓬勃发展,4G、5G网络的普及,实时音视频逐渐走进千家万户,包围了我们的生活和工作。 什么是好姐妹,消息几百年不回,然后在抖音若无其事的艾特你,晚上互道晚安后,在抖音还能碰见! 现在大家没事的时候就喜欢拿出手机刷抖音,看直播,用户群体大,男...
Android
音视频
2021-11-17
0
489
Android入门教程 | IO 操作之读写文件
读写文件 读写 CSV 文件 CSV: Comma-Separated Values 逗号分隔的文本文件 读写csv文件和读写普通文件类似;写的时候给数据之间添加上逗号。 设定存储路径和文件名: private static final String FILE_FOLDER = En...
Android
2021-11-16
0
782
如何掌握 Framwork?《Android Framework 精编内核解析》,深入解析源码!
前言 前段时间朋友在找 Android 高级开发工作,想进一步提升自己的能力,看了很多招聘信息,都要求熟练掌握 Framwork,了解底层原理等,发现是不是该深入研究底层技术…... 同时在网上也看到过相关问题,有很多人在关注 "了解 Android 的 Framework 层对工作...
Android
Framework
2021-11-16
0
557
Android入门教程 | AsyncTask 使用介绍
AsyncTask 有助于使用 UI 线程。这个类能让你不主动使用多线程或 Handler,在子线程种执行耗时任务,并在UI线程发布结果。 AsyncTask 是一个在不需要开发者直接操作多线程和 Handler 的情况下的帮助类,适用于短时间的操作(最多几秒)。 如需长时间的线程操作,建议使用多线...
Android
2021-11-15
0
397
Android入门教程 | Kotlin协程入门
Android官方推荐使用协程来处理异步问题。 协程的特点: 轻量:单个线程上可运行多个协程。协程支持挂起,不会使正在运行协程的线程阻塞。挂起比阻塞节省内存,且支持多个并行操作。 内存泄漏更少:使用结构化并发机制在一个作用域内执行多项操作。 内置取消支持:取消操作会自动在运行中的整个协程层次结构内...
Android
kotlin
2021-11-12
0
468
首页
上一页
4
5
6
7
8
9
10
11
12
13
下一页
末页